Programming is a weird field because the typical interview dress code is assumed to be business casual or even casual. Suits aren't really done in most parts of the field, even for interviews. It isn't uncommon to find places who'll cut a candidate for dressing too formally because they assume it means she'll be too straight-laced to work for them. (Which is hella stupid, but whatever.) So yeah, for a normal job interview, this outfit would have been far too casual—in tech . . . eh. It depends on the company. I know of plenty of companies where that would have been fine as an interview outfit (and others where it wouldn't). She gambled and lost. It happens.
Cutting an otherwise stellar candidate because they had a run in their stockings is idiotic—I guess maybe if it was a male interviewer/an all-male office, they might not know that if you put them on in the morning you've got a 50/50 chance of having a run in them by the end of the day? But I suspect that her lateness was the biggest issue—either she didn't actually warn them that she was going to be late, that message was not noted/passed on from whomever she did tell, or when she told them that she was going to be “a few minutes” late, they assumed 5, not 20.
|